
大数据存储用哪些数据库
常见问答
大数据存储应选择哪些类型的数据库?
在处理海量数据时,适合使用哪些数据库类型来实现高效存储和查询?
适合大数据的数据库类型介绍
处理大数据时,常用的数据库类型包括分布式数据库、NoSQL数据库和列式数据库。分布式数据库能将数据分散存储,提高可扩展性;NoSQL数据库如MongoDB和Cassandra适合存储非结构化或半结构化数据;列式数据库如HBase和Google Bigtable适合进行大规模数据分析。选择合适的数据库类型可根据实际业务需求和数据特点决定。
大数据存储的数据库如何支持高并发访问?
面对大量用户同时访问数据的情况,哪些数据库特性能够保证高效响应和稳定性?
数据库对高并发访问的支持特性
大数据环境中,数据库通过分布式架构、数据分片、负载均衡以及内存缓存等技术支持高并发访问。分布式数据库可以并行处理请求,降低单点压力;数据分片使读写操作更加高效;负载均衡分配访问请求,防止部分节点过载;缓存机制加快数据访问速度。综合利用这些特性能有效提升大数据存储系统的并发处理能力。
选择大数据存储数据库时应考虑哪些因素?
为了满足不同业务需求,应该从哪些方面评估并选择合适的大数据存储数据库?
选型大数据存储数据库的重要考量点
选择大数据存储数据库时,需综合考虑数据类型(结构化、非结构化)、数据规模、查询性能需求、一致性与可用性需求、扩展性以及维护成本。此外,支持的数据模型、支持的数据处理框架(如与Spark或Hadoop的兼容性)、社区活跃度和生态系统完善程度也十分重要。选择符合业务场景和技术需求的数据库能保障大数据应用的高效运行。